England through to Euro 2020 last 16 before Czech Republic match thanks to Denmark win
England will definitely head into the Euro 2020 last-16 even if they lose to Czech Republic on Tuesday.
The Three Lions could suffer the ignominy of finishing third in Group D but still go through as their four points would make them one of the best third-placed teams.
UEFA’s format for the tournament means that four of the best third-placed teams go through to the knockout round.
It means that England could face the strange prospect of a disappointing defeat against Czech Republic on Tuesday but still go through.
Gareth Southgate’s side started their Euro 2020 campaign with a 1-0 victory over Croatia.
Raheem Sterling scored the only goal midway through the second half in a positive performance.
